~3 min read • Updated Feb 14, 2026
1. ایجاد حساب دمو در cPanel
حسابهای دمو به کاربران اجازه میدهند بدون امکان ایجاد تغییر، محیط cPanel را بررسی کنند. شما میتوانید یک حساب موجود را به حالت دمو ببرید یا یک حساب جدید بسازید.
1.1 انتخاب یا ساخت حساب
نکته: حسابهای ریسلر را نمیتوان به دمو تبدیل کرد.
برای ساخت حساب جدید:
- رفتن به WHM » Account Functions » Create a New Account
- وارد کردن دامنه
- انتخاب یا ویرایش نام کاربری
- ساخت رمز عبور یا استفاده از Password Generator
- وارد کردن ایمیل
- کلیک روی Create
1.2 فعالسازی Demo Mode
پس از انتخاب حساب، Demo Mode را فعال کنید تا حساب به حالت دمو تبدیل شود. کاربران فقط میتوانند محیط را مشاهده کنند.
1.3 حذف حساب دمو
- رفتن به WHM » Account Functions » Terminate Accounts
- انتخاب حساب دمو
- کلیک روی Remove
2. ساخت ریسلر WHM بدون دامنه
WHM امکان ساخت کاربرانی را میدهد که بدون داشتن cPanel، فقط به WHM دسترسی داشته باشند. این نوع حساب برای کارمندان یا مدیران کمکی مناسب است.
هشدار: برخی بخشهای WHM برای این نوع حسابها کار نمیکند.
2.1 ساخت با WHM API 1
سریعترین روش:
- اتصال SSH به سرور با
root - اجرای دستور زیر:
whmapi1 createacct username=user password=password reseller_without_domain=1نکته: حتماً پارامتر reseller_without_domain را وارد کنید.
پس از ساخت، باید دسترسیها را از طریق لینک خروجی API یا با setacls تنظیم کنید.
2.2 ساخت دستی
برای ساخت دستی:
- اتصال SSH به سرور
- ساخت کاربر:
useradd -Um username- تنظیم رمز عبور:
passwd username- تنظیم سطح دسترسی پوشه Home:
chmod -v 711 /home/username- افزودن کاربر به فایل ریسلرها:
echo "username:" >> /var/cpanel/resellers- بررسی فایل
/var/cpanel/users/username
اگر وجود داشت، خط DNS= را حذف کنید. اگر نبود:
echo USER=username > /var/cpanel/users/username
chmod 0640 /var/cpanel/users/username
chgrp username /var/cpanel/users/username- ورود به WHM
- رفتن به Resellers » Edit Reseller Nameservers and Privileges
- انتخاب کاربر و تعیین دسترسیها
2.3 تغییر رمز عبور
این نوع حساب از طریق WHM قابل تغییر رمز نیست. فقط از SSH:
passwd username2.4 حذف حساب ریسلر بدون دامنه (API)
- اتصال SSH
- اجرای دستور:
whmapi1 removeacct username=user2.5 حذف دستی
- حذف فایل کاربر:
rm /var/cpanel/users/username- حذف نام کاربر از
/var/cpanel/resellers - حذف کاربر از سیستم:
userdel username2.6 محدودیتها
- برخی رابطها مانند File Restoration و SSL CSR کار نمیکنند.
- رمز عبور فقط از طریق SSH قابل تغییر است.
- ایمیل تماس ندارد و اعلانها کار نمیکنند.
- با
pkgacctقابل بکاپگیری نیست.
مهم: پس از ساخت، دستور زیر را اجرا کنید:
/usr/local/cpanel/scripts/updateuserdomains3. غیرفعالسازی Filesystem Quotas
Quotaها میزان فضای دیسک هر حساب را محدود میکنند. در برخی شرایط برای بهبود عملکرد، لازم است آنها را غیرفعال کنید.
3.1 غیرفعالسازی روی Root XFS
- اتصال SSH
- ویرایش فایل
/etc/default/grubو حذف خط:
rootflags=uquota- بهروزرسانی GRUB:
grub2-mkconfig --output=/boot/grub2/grub.cfg- غیرفعالسازی quota:
xfs_quota -x -c 'off' -c 'remove' /- ریبوت سرور
- بررسی:
mount | grep ' / 'باید noquota نمایش داده شود.
3.2 غیرفعالسازی روی XFS غیر Root
- ویرایش
/etc/fstabو حذفuquota - غیرفعالسازی:
xfs_quota -x -c 'off' -c 'remove' path_to_mount- Remount:
mount -o remount path_to_mountنیازی به ریبوت نیست.
نتیجهگیری
این مقاله تمام مراحل ساخت حساب دمو، ساخت و حذف ریسلر بدون دامنه، و غیرفعالسازی quota را پوشش میدهد. این ابزارها به مدیران کمک میکنند کنترل دقیقتری روی دسترسیها، عملکرد و مدیریت سرور داشته باشند.
Written & researched by Dr. Shahin Siami